There are several types of diabetes insipidus: Central. This is when the hypothalamus or pituitary gland doesn’t make or send out enough ADH. It can happen if the hypothalamus or pituitary gland are damaged. That can be caused by a head wound, including surgery on the pituitary gland.

Increased frequency ... WebFeb 6, 2024 · Nephrogenic diabetes insipidus (NDI) is a rare kidney disorder that may be inherited or acquired. NDI is not related to the more common diabetes mellitus (sugar diabetes), in which the body does not produce or properly use insulin. NDI is a distinct disorder caused by complete or partial resistance of the kidneys to arginine vasopressin …
